Exploring the World of Taboo Charming Mother (Volumes 1-6) Taboo Charming Mother (Japanese: 艶母, Enbo ) is a well-known adult anime (hentai) series and manga that delves into a dark, provocative narrative involving family secrets and illicit desires. Originally a manga series by Tsuzuru Miyabi, it was adapted into a six-episode Original Video Animation (OVA) series produced between 2003 and 2005. The "Enbo" manga by Tsuzuru Miyabi is the foundation of the franchise, consisting of (or a single kanzenban complete edition) containing 22 chapters . On MyAnimeList , the manga holds a score of 7.18 from over 600 users, with fans often praising the "old artstyle" as "really amazing". The manga is noted for the art and its psychological themes, but some reviewers have criticized the plot for leaning on blackmail tropes. The manga's publication history includes several "one-shots" included in the collected volumes, which are shorter, unrelated stories that often expand on the themes present in the main narrative.

Directed by Kan Fukumoto for episodes 1–3, with Shigeki Awai taking over for episodes 4–6.
